He mentions you... WebOct 4, 2007 · Compressed oxygen for torches is close to 100%. Oxy fuel cutting with only 99% oxygen is 50% as efficient as cutting with conventional compressed oxygen, and doesn't work at all below 98% oxygen. The air/fuel torches introduce the air with a venturi, and this provides ample air flow. Nothing is to be gained from using compressed air.

WebMay 1, 2024 · Cutting torches (and cutting attachments for combination torches) mix fuel gas and oxygen using different technologies. Those with a spiral mixer (also often called an equal pressure mixer) are calibrated to work with both alternative fuel gases (which use lower delivery pressures) and acetylene (which uses slightly higher delivery pressures).
